Elliott Levine

Elliott Levine is Chief Academic Officer for HP Americas Education. A former K-12 official and regular public speaker, he has worked for and launched start-ups in the education and marketing industries. He is featured as one of three HP employees making a difference at www.hp.com/go/jobs.
